R
Roman
Гость
case != id -1) неизвестен. 1:20"); момент на SendClientMessageToAll(COLOR_WHITE,"Администратор #define case { else 100: который RolikCheckpoint[id] начнется {1370.2609,-934.4410,34.1875}, {1707.0135,-760.7014,52.4240}, В 10.000р. начнется (где true)) на = 1) в на if(RolikCheckpoint[id] == if(IsPlayerInRangeOfPoint(i,8.0,GonkaNaRolikax[0][0],GonkaNaRolikax[0][1],GonkaNaRolikax[0][2])) начнется { 1:00"); case if(RolikCheckpoint { RolikCheckpoint[id] 0; 1:50"); id денег все третий 30000 1; на SetPlayerCheckpoint(i,GonkaNaRolikax[1][0],GonkaNaRolikax[1][1],GonkaNaRolikax[1][2],3); на DisablePlayerCheckpoint(i); } код RolikiMesto_2 #define 1:30"); на на } глобальным начинается пишет, запускает 0; {798.5080,-1149.0479,23.9775}, } кто = 70: SendClientMessageToAll(COLOR_WHITE,"Гонка RolikiPos на из else через 1:40"); < != == return else } через через if(PlayerInfo[playerid][pAdmin] #define SendClientMessageToAll(COLOR_WHITE,"Гонка RolikCheckpoint[playerid] гонку SendClientMessageToAll(COLOR_WHITE,"Гонка SendClientMessageToAll(COLOR_WHITE,"Гонка гонка. 10000 if(RolikCheckpoint[playerid] транспортного роликах",name,RolikiPos); } через через return работает = начнется == { } можете оптимизировал места. GivePlayerMoney(playerid,RolikiMesto_3); { -1; на SendClientMessageToAll(COLOR_WHITE,"Администратор 1) каждую OnPlayerCommandText = роликов!"); В = гонку ++; < i SetPlayerCheckpoint(playerid,GonkaNaRolikax[RolikCheckpoint[playerid]][0],GonkaNaRolikax[RolikCheckpoint[playerid]][1],GonkaNaRolikax[RolikCheckpoint[playerid]][2],3); за TimeBeforeRolikStart в на через case = администратор на != MAX_PLAYERS; = через id { id RolikiGonkaIdet public return { < роликах 0; case { TimeBeforeRolikStart 92 0) - #define роликах RolikCheckpoint[playerid] остановить роликах начнется 6) if(GetPlayerSkin(playerid) < == 40: "/startrace", роликах ++) public 0:50"); роликах GivePlayerMoney(playerid,RolikiMesto_2); = роликах!"); if(TimeBeforeRolikStart > роликах всем } new } return {1698.2628,-486.6554,50.5412}, return OnPlayerConnect { -1) роликах <= case MAX_PLAYERS; { 1; if(RolikiPos 120; 0:20"); new case -1; (тот case лишь -1; начнется 6) получает 9 на роликах через 3) изменить = SendClientMessageToAll(COLOR_YELLOW,string); немного В if(PlayerInfo[playerid][pAdmin] = { 80: 2 } case RolikiMesto_3 в выдачу true)) for(new 30.000р, if(IsPlayerInAnyVehicle(playerid)) = нехорошо! GetPlayerSkin(playerid) 0:10"); { new 0:40"); на DisablePlayerCheckpoint(id); SendClientMessageToAll(COLOR_WHITE,"Гонка и if(!strcmp(cmd, 1; В SendClientMessageToAll(COLOR_WHITE,"Гонка RolikCheckpoint тебе "/stoprace", первым if(RolikCheckpoint[playerid] else SendClientMessageToAll(COLOR_WHITE,"Гонка минуты"); 50: - через } В переменным 99) таймер TimeBeforeRolikStart пришел case секунду): < = -1) 90: { {1343.0232,-1143.7323,23.6696}, 0:30"); if(!strcmp(cmd, роликах!"); Float:GonkaNaRolikax[10][3] на 60: == -1; гонке public OnPlayerEnterCheckpoint 9) {929.7842,-674.3187,118.4844}, DisablePlayerCheckpoint(playerid); Сумму TimeBeforeRolikStart } i SendClientMessageToAll(COLOR_WHITE,"Гонка Я Игрок 0) нет else --; 20000 {1273.3207,-605.4467,101.9943}, else 0; 110: 0; Вылазь RolikCheckpoint[playerid] = {1499.1722,-424.8036,34.0544}, 1:10"); != DisablePlayerCheckpoint(playerid); RolikCheckpoint[playerid] конце = id через на К { - Администратор = {1037.2098,-782.0674,104.0520}, /startrace начнется начнется на каким SetPlayerCheckpoint(id,GonkaNaRolikax[0][0],GonkaNaRolikax[0][1],GonkaNaRolikax[0][2],3); -1; format(string,sizeof(string),"%s Автор: 1; for(new 0; через начнется } id через for(new роликах if(RolikiGonkaIdet секундный 20: и первые { 10: GivePlayerMoney(playerid,RolikiMesto_1); case RolikiGonkaIdet RolikiPos минуты 0; SendClientMessageToAll(COLOR_WHITE,"Гонка == роликах гонку if(RolikiPos роликах /stoprace гонку } роликах 2) роликах началась!"); начинает средства!"); 20.000р, 0 заканчивает SendClientMessage(playerid,COLOR_GREY,"На i++) - 1; 1; ++; RolikiPos -1; 2 TimeBeforeRolikStart case MAX_PLAYERS; RolikiGonkaIdet ++) -1) 0; 1; if(RolikiPos второй SendClientMessage(playerid,COLOR_GREY,"Жульничать 30: -1; return гонки else == = } new SendClientMessageToAll(COLOR_WHITE,"Гонка Ко {664.5610,-1313.6588,13.4609}}; может new): пришел. new TimeBeforeRolikStart SendClientMessageToAll(COLOR_WHITE,"Гонка <= начнется пришедший начнется RolikCheckpoint != = if(RolikCheckpoint[playerid] 1; = { return && начнется сделал } } дефайнах. = %d три 0: } SendClientMessageToAll(COLOR_WHITE,"Гонка && RolikiPos && через Также, { RolikiMesto_1 SendClientMessageToAll(COLOR_WHITE,"Гонка = switch(TimeBeforeRolikStart) { любой RolikCheckpoint[MAX_PLAYERS]; if(RolikCheckpoint[playerid]